Output 37c968a9323887a1c82c58427aa184f77577b53aadea35d107e0f09676399762:1

value
153530
script pubkey
OP_0 OP_PUSHBYTES_20 bc04893126ac81bea6f4a30949866c859e708bbf
address
ltc1qhszgjvfx4jqmafh55vy5npnvsk08pzalcj4uf8
transaction
37c968a9323887a1c82c58427aa184f77577b53aadea35d107e0f09676399762
spent
true